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Zinvié, is also a moderately hot month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 27.4°C (81.3°F) and an average low of 23.8°C (74.8°F).

Temperature

August, having an average high-temperature of 27.4°C (81.3°F) and an average low-temperature of 23.8°C (74.8°F), is the coldest month.

Heat index

The heat index value during August is calculated to be a tropical 31°C (87.8°F). Enduring exposure and ongoing activity could cause a sense of fatigue and subsequent heat cramps.
For clarity, heat index numbers account for light winds and areas under shade. Direct exposure to sunshine could lead to a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', shows a temperature sensation when both heat and moisture conditions are combined. The influence of weather can be personal, changing with an individual's body mass, height, and level of physical exertion. When you're directly under the sun's rays, remember that the heat index may surge by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ular importance for children. Kids are generally in more danger than adults because they perspire less. Their large skin surface area compared to their small bodies and the excessive heat due to their actions raises their risk.

Humidity

August and September, with an average relative humidity of 83%, are the most humid months in Zinvié.

Rainfall

In August, in Zinvié, Benin, the rain falls for 15.3 days. Throughout August, 28mm (1.1")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Zinvié, there are 204.5 rainfall days, and 599mm (23.58")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August in Zinvié is 12h and 20min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:44 and sunset at 19:09. On the last day of August, in Zinvié, sunrise is at 06:43 and sunset at 18:58 WAT.

Sunshine

In August, the average sunshine in Zinvié is 6.5h.

UV index

July and August,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index in Zinvié.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: In August, the maximum UV index of 6 suggests this advice:
Use protective steps and abide by sun safety guidelines. Safeguarding against skin and eye harm is necessary. Minimize exposure to direct sunlight and seek shade from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most intense, but remember that shade structures may not offer complete protection. Counter UV radiation's ill effects with clothing designed for sun safety and UV-resistant eyewear.
